Swatara Township, Lebanon County, Pennsylvania

It is part of the Lebanon, PA Metropolitan Statistical Area.

[2] According to the United States Census Bureau, the township has a total area of 21.2 square miles (54.9 km2), of which 21.2 square miles (54.8 km2) is land and 0.05% is water.

As of the census[4] of 2000, there were 3,941 people, 1,432 households, and 1,125 families residing in the township.

There were 1,487 housing units at an average density of 70.2 per square mile (27.1/km2).

17.1% of all households were made up of individuals, and 5.2% had someone living alone who was 65 years of age or older.
